đŽ How to Play Sliding Puzzle
Controls: Click tiles adjacent to the empty space to slide them
The puzzle has numbered tiles and one empty space. Click any tile next to the empty space to slide it. Arrange all tiles in order from 1 to 15.
đĄ Tips & Strategy
- Solve the top row first, then the left column, then move down
- Don't move randomly â each move counts
- Use the corners as anchor points for solved pieces
- Plan 3-4 moves ahead before making the next move
đ About Sliding Puzzle
The 15-puzzle was invented around 1874 by Noyes Palmer Chapman. It became a worldwide craze in 1880, with newspapers offering rewards for solutions.
